Rescue workers pull bodies from al-Mawasi camp after Israeli attack

At least 10 people have been killed in an Israeli bombing of a cluster of tents in al-Mawasi. The coastal area was once an Israeli-designated “safe zone”, but since Israel resumed its Gaza bombing campaign on March 18, it has not marked any areas as protected.

Israeli shelling targets ICU at Gaza City children’s hospital: Health Ministry

The Palestinian Health Ministry has reported that the Israeli military shelled Al-Durra Children’s Hospital in the al-Tuffah neighbourhood of Gaza City.

An Israeli air strike also targeted solar panels at the facility, the ministry said in a post on Telegram.

One person killed in Israeli attack on al-Mawasi

At least one person has been killed by Israeli live fire in al-Mawasi, southern Gaza, Wafa reported. At the same time, Israeli forces bombed a tent for displaced people in the camp, and Israeli helicopters also opened fire east of Khan Younis.

Meanwhile, heavy artillery was fired east of Maghazi camp in the central Gaza Strip. In the Shujayea neighbourhood, a quadcopter drone burned five tents housing displaced people in the Ard al-Bardini area on as-Sikka Street.
